A P2P lending platform is different from a conventional loan-management system. Instead of only managing loans issued by a single financial institution, the platform may facilitate interactions between multiple participants while maintaining separate records for borrowers, lenders, loan requests, repayments, transactions, and platform activity.

What Is P2P Lending Software?

P2P Lending Software is a digital platform used to facilitate and manage peer-to-peer lending activities between eligible lenders and borrowers through an online system.

A typical platform may include:

Lender Registration
Borrower Registration
KYC
Loan Application
Assessment
Listing
Lender Participation
Funding
Disbursement
Repayment
Distribution
Account Closure

The exact workflow depends on the business model, platform structure, applicable regulations, and required integrations.

A well-designed P2P platform needs to manage multiple user types and maintain accurate records for every financial event.

Loan Listing Management

One of the distinguishing features of P2P lending is the ability to present eligible borrowing opportunities through a platform.

Once an application has completed the required processing stages, the platform can create a loan listing according to the configured workflow.

A listing may contain permitted information such as:

  • Loan amount
  • Tenure
  • Applicable return/interest information
  • Repayment structure
  • Risk-related information
  • Funding status
  • Remaining amount

The information displayed to lenders should be designed according to the applicable regulatory and disclosure requirements.

Transaction Ledger & Audit Trail

P2P lending platforms require strong transaction visibility because multiple parties may be associated with the same loan.

The software can maintain records of relevant events including:

  • Deposits
  • Participation
  • Funding
  • Disbursement
  • Repayment
  • Distribution
  • Fees
  • Adjustments
  • Refunds
  • Withdrawals

Audit-oriented records can help authorized administrators investigate transactions and maintain operational transparency.
